Job Description Summary:

Responsible for the preparation of hot foods for patients and retail customers. Is responsible for cleaning, sanitizing, and orderly appearance of equipment and work area.

Responsibilities And Duties:
  • 70% Prepares hot and cold foods for patients and retail customers according to production sheets. Documents on appropriate food safety logs in a timely manner. Accurately follows standardized recipes for in-house production. Proper use of cooking and prep equipment.
  • 25% Responsible for following safe food handling practices, maintaining cleanliness, sanitation and order of work area and equipment. Notifies supervisors of equipment malfunctions, and food preparation problems. Performs basic housekeeping duties & maintains clean attractive area. Relieves and trains other positions as assigned. Obtains necessary stock
  • 5% Other duties as assigned

As a High Reliability Organization (HRO), responsibilities require focus on safety, quality and efficiency in performing job duties.

The job profile provides an overview of responsibilities and duties and is not intended to be an exhaustive list and is subject to change at any time

Minimum Qualifications:
Additional Job Description:

Must be able to read, write, understand verbal/written instructions and be able to perform basic math calculations. Must be able to learn and understand safe and sanitary food handling techniques as well as modified diets. Preparation of hot food items in large volume. Proper use of convection ovens, grills, fryers, knives, and mixers. etc. Creative food garnishing techniques. One year food preparation experience preferred.
